In precision engineering and manufacturing, component fitment and structural integrity are paramount. is a German industrial standard that governs the design, geometry, and dimensions of thread run-outs and thread undercuts . It ensures a standardized, smooth transition at the termination point of a thread. This prevents burrs, incomplete thread configurations, and assembly interferences. din 76a pdf

Without an undercut, a mating part (like a nut) would hit the incomplete "run-out" threads at the end of the screw, preventing it from tightening flush against the shoulder. is a German industrial standard that governs the
